Introduction.- The Hydrogen Evolution Reaction: Water Reduction Photocatalysis-Improved Niobate Nanoscroll Photocatalysts for Partial Water Splitting.- The Oxygen Evolution Reaction: Water Oxidation Photocatalysis-Photocatalytic Water Oxidation with Suspended alpha-Fe2O3 Particles - Effects of Nanoscaling.- Complete Water Splitting with Multi-Component Catalysts-Overall Water Splitting with Suspended NiO-STO nanocrystals.- Complete Water Splitting with Multi-Component Catalysts-Proposed Mechanism of Charge Transport in NiOx loaded SrTiO3 Photocatalyst for Complete Water Splitting.
